Popular diet practiced for weight loss may cause accelerated aging: study suggests that ketogenic diet promotes cellular senescence in multiple organs by stabilizing p53 in an AMPK dependent manner. science.org/doi/10.1126/scia…

Preprint alert 🚨🚨. It is known that mitochondrial impairments cause premature aging. But "natural causes" of mitochondrial demise during normal aging are obscure. Here we identify membrane lipid phosphatidylcholine as a mendable culprit of mito-aging 🧵

Our most surprising observation: metabolic effects identical to days-weeks of dietary restriction are achieved in just 12-24 hours with a single low-dose ultraviolet B treatment in mice that have free access to unlimited food. Weight loss without sport, diet or drugs? (see🧵).
Replacing diet 🍏 with light💡: our new preprint shows that ultraviolet B treatment replicates effects of fasting in ad libitum fed animals (worms & mice) by triggering transient mitochondrial fragmentation. Clinical applications are in development.

Why do organisms age? We attempted to present a unified overview of evolutionary genetic and physiological theories of ageing, with a focus on emerging evolutionary physiological theory – developmental theory of ageing (DTA): bit.ly/4c59xiG 1/5
🚨🚨Our new paper describes interventions that extend lifespan and health span via active suppression of energy metabolism. We also propose that diets, which activate TOR (e.g. high protein), may accelerate metabolic aging in the long-term (🧵below). nature.com/articles/s41467-0…
